Katie Lucas
Katie Rose Lucas (born April 13, 1988) is an American actress and writer. She is the daughter of filmmaker George Lucas,[1] god-daughter of both Steven Spielberg and Francis Ford Coppola, younger sister of Amanda Lucas, and older sister of Jett Lucas and Everest Hobson Lucas.[2][3] Her father adopted her and Jett as a single parent.[2]
Lucas had minor roles in all three Star Wars prequels. She portrayed young Anakin's friend, Amee, in The Phantom Menace; the purple Twi'lek girl Lunae Minx in Attack of the Clones; and Senator Chi Eekway in Revenge of the Sith.[1]
Lucas was a writer for the Star Wars: The Clone Wars TV series.[4]
